Analysis
The most recent figure for emissions from livestock — emissions (co2eq) from ch4, per square in Germany is 0.0932 kt per square kilometre, measured in 2023.
That represents a change of up 0.3% on the previous year and down 15.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, emissions from livestock — emissions (co2eq) from ch4, per square in Germany peaked at 0.1816 kt per square kilometre in 1985 and was at its lowest, 0.0929 kt per square kilometre, in 2022.
Germany ranks 16th of 170 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 63 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 0.1614 kt per square kilometre | 0.1571 kt per square kilometre | 0.1668 kt per square kilometre | 9 |
| 1970s | 0.169 kt per square kilometre | 0.1638 kt per square kilometre | 0.175 kt per square kilometre | 10 |
| 1980s | 0.1774 kt per square kilometre | 0.171 kt per square kilometre | 0.1816 kt per square kilometre | 10 |
| 1990s | 0.137 kt per square kilometre | 0.1244 kt per square kilometre | 0.1668 kt per square kilometre | 10 |
| 2000s | 0.114 kt per square kilometre | 0.109 kt per square kilometre | 0.1215 kt per square kilometre | 10 |
| 2010s | 0.1075 kt per square kilometre | 0.1003 kt per square kilometre | 0.1106 kt per square kilometre | 10 |
| 2020s | 0.0951 kt per square kilometre | 0.0929 kt per square kilometre | 0.0997 kt per square kilometre | 4 |

How this figure is calculated
Emissions from livestock — Emissions (CO2eq) from CH4 (AR5)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Emissions from livestock — Emissions (CO2eq) from CH4 (AR5)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
Computed from
- Emissions from livestock — Emissions (CO2eq) from CH4 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ations
- Land area FAOSTAT,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(FAO)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
